Tumor protein D52-like 1 (TPD52L1) is a member of the tumor protein D52-like gene family, characterized by coiled-coil domains that enable protein-protein interactions, forming both homomers and heteromers. It is implicated in **cell proliferation** and **calcium signaling** and interacts specifically with mitogen-activated protein kinase kinase kinase 5 (**MAP3K5/ASK1**), thereby promoting ASK1-induced apoptosis. Alternative splicing variants include isoforms capable of interacting with 14-3-3 proteins, suggesting a role as a signaling intermediary and possible vesicle trafficking regulation. TPD52L1 is overexpressed in some cancers, notably **breast cancer**, and is considered a potential biomarker. No approved drugs directly target TPD52L1, and while its dysfunction or altered expression is clearly associated with malignant transformation, it is not classified as a typical receptor, enzyme, transporter, or ion channel
If targeted: Potential mechanisms might include inhibition of cell proliferation or disruption of calcium-mediated signaling or apoptosis modulation, but currently there are no clinically approved drugs acting directly on TPD52L1
